What is auto insurance SR22 ?

SR22 insurance, typically described as SR-22, is an auto liability insurance paper needed by the majority of state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) workplaces for certain motorists. This insurance acts as evidence that a motorist has the minimum needed liability insurance coverage from the state. The value of it is that it enables the car driver to keep or restore driving privileges after particular traffic-related offenses. It's important to understand that it is not a kind of auto insurance, however a confirmation that the insurance company attests the motorist, promising to cover any kind of future cases.

The need for an SR-22 kind represents that the person has had a gap in protection or has actually been associated with an accident without adequate insurance to cover damages. The insurance company provides the SR-22 forms to the state DMV to verify the driver's financial responsibility, showing they are currently suitably insured. The SR-22 is a time-bound requirement, which means it is not an irreversible mark on a car driver's record. This process ensures that the driver lugs at least the minimal liability insurance the states mandate. Hence, SR-22 Insurance plays an essential role in structure depend on between the insurer and the insured.

How much does SR-22 insurance fee?

The fee of SR-22 insurance can differ commonly based on numerous variables such as an individual's driving record, the factor for the SR-22 requirement, and the state where the motorist lives. The instant economic effect comes in the kind of a filing fee, which usually ranges from $15 to $25. Nevertheless, the much more significant cost originates from the expected increase in auto insurance rate. The affirmation of a policy gap causing a need for SR-22 attracts the representation of the car driver as high danger in the eyes of auto insurance providers. A high-risk label can associate substantially to the walk in regular monthly rates.

Additional making complex the fee computation is the sort of protection needed. While a non-owner car insurance policy may set you back less than an owner's policy, the explicit need for an enhanced amount of protection can intensify premiums. Many states mandate a minimum quantity of liability insurance coverage, consisting of both bodily injury and property damage liability, of which a reasonable amount should be shown in the insurance policy bundled with the SR-22 type. To add fuel to the fire, in some states like Florida and Virginia, FR-44 insurance, which needs even greater liability insurance coverage, could be a mandate. In short, while the actual fee of filing an SR-22 type is relatively reduced, the indirect prices arising from its effect on auto insurance rates and liability insurance requirements can produce a hole in your pocket.

What's the big difference between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both forms of insurance certifications used by states to validate a car driver's financial responsibility and ensure they satisfy the respective state's minimal auto insurance requirements. The significant distinction between these certifications largely lies in the function they serve and the liability limits. With an SR-22, frequently needed for individuals with Drunk drivings or major driving offenses, the liability requirements resemble those of a typical vehicle insurance policy. This accreditation can be acquired by including it to a current policy or by safeguarding a non-owner policy if the person does not own an automobile.

FR-44, on the other hand, specifies to 2 states-- Virginia and Florida, and includes greater liability limits, specifically for bodily injury liability. It's generally mandated for people needing to have a hardship license after a significant driving offense, such as a drunk driving where injury or substantial home damages took place. Furthermore, FR-44 filing period is normally longer and the average cost more than that of SR-22, because of the increased insurance coverage it calls for. What takes place if an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ated?

The cancellation of an SR-22 insurance policy can usually result in severe consequences. When an insurance holder's SR-22 insurance is terminated - whether because of non-payment, plan lapse, or any other reason - insurance service providers have an obligation to signal the proper state authorities regarding this modification. This is achieved by filing an SR-26 type, which properly symbolizes completion of the insurance policy holder's SR-22 insurance protection.

As soon as the proper state authorities have actually been alerted of the termination of SR-22 insurance, the impacted motorist's permit might potentially be put on hold once again. This is due to the authorities' requirement to guarantee that the drivers are constantly gu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ement. Just what is SR22 insurance?

SR22 insurance is a certificate of financial responsibility that is called for by some states for high-risk vehicle drivers. It's not an insurance policy itself, but a document offered by your insurance company that shows you have liability coverage on your automobile insurance policy.

Just how does SR-22 insurance operate?

SR-22 insurance operates as an evidence of vehicle insurance. If you're called for to have an SR-22 and you currently have auto insurance, you'll just require to add it to your existing policy.

Who are the individuals that need SR-22 insurance?

SR-22 insurance is normally required for car drivers who exactly've been founded guilty of a DRUNK DRIVING, DUI, reckless driving, driving without insurance, or other serious traffic violations.

Exactly how can I obtain SR-22 insurance?

You can obtain SR-22 insurance by calling your car insurance company. They will certainly add it to your existing policy and then file the SR-22 type with the state in your place.

How much time does it take to safeguard SR-22 insurance?

The size of time it requires to safeguard SR-22 insurance depends on the insurance company, but it's usually a fast process once you've purchased the essential insurance coverage.

What are the prices associated with SR-22 insurance?

The price of SR-22 insurance varies by state and insurance company. There is typically a charge to file the SR-22 form, and your insurance premiums might increase as a result of the high-risk status.

Is it feasible to acquire an SR-22 insurance policy on-line?

Yes, numerous insurer allow you to buy SR-22 insurance on the internet. However, you might require to talk to a representative to finalize the process.

Which states need SR-22 insurance?

Needs for SR-22 insurance vary by state. Not all states need SR-22 insurance, so it's essential to examine neighborhood guidelines.

How much time is SR-22 insurance commonly needed?

The requirement for SR-22 insurance generally lasts for regarding three years, however it can vary relying on the state and the intensity of the driving infraction.

What's the difference in between SR-22 and FR-44?

Both SR-22 and FR-44 are forms of financial responsibility that provide evidence of auto insurance. The major difference is that FR-44 is required in Florida and Virginia for motorists convicted of a DUI and typically requires greater liability limits than the SR-22.

What are the consequences of having an SR-22 insurance policy terminated?

If an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ated or lapses, your insurer is called for to notify the state, which can lead to the suspension of your motorist's license. It's necessary to keep SR-22 insurance for the full needed period to avoid additional charges.
